Is It Worth Buying Down Mortgage Rate?

Purchasing a property is one of the most significant financial decisions you will make in your lifetime. When considering a home purchase, it’s crucial to carefully evaluate your mortgage options. One factor to contemplate is whether buying down your mortgage rate is worth it. Let’s explore what buying down mortgage rates entails and analyze whether it’s a good investment for you.

Understanding Mortgage Rates

Mortgage rates are the interest rates applied to your home loan. They determine how much you’ll pay in interest over the life of the loan. Lower mortgage rates can result in substantial savings, reducing your overall monthly mortgage payment and saving you thousands of dollars in interest over time.

What is Buying Down a Mortgage Rate?

Buying down a mortgage rate refers to paying additional money upfront to the lender in exchange for a lower interest rate. This upfront payment is referred to as discount points or mortgage points. Each point typically costs 1% of your total loan amount and can reduce your mortgage rate by a specific percentage, usually 0.25% per point. Benefits of Buying Down Your Mortgage Rate

Buying down your mortgage rate can provide several benefits, including:

  • Reduced Monthly Payments: By lowering your mortgage rate, you can decrease your monthly mortgage payment, allowing you to free up funds for other expenses or savings.
  • Long-term Savings: Over the life of your loan, a lower interest rate can result in significant savings in interest payments.
  • Lower Debt-to-Income Ratio (DTI): A lower mortgage rate can reduce your DTI ratio, which is beneficial if you’re applying for additional credit in the future.
  • Increased Affordability: With a lower mortgage rate, you may qualify for a larger loan amount, enabling you to purchase a more expensive property.
  • Stability: Locking in a lower interest rate can provide long-term stability and protection against potential rate hikes in the future.

Considerations Before Buying Down Your Mortgage Rate

While buying down your mortgage rate can offer advantages, there are a few key factors to keep in mind before making this investment:

  • Length of Stay: If you plan to sell your property in the near future, the potential savings from buying down your mortgage rate might not outweigh the upfront costs.
  • Break-Even Point: Calculate how long it will take to recoup the additional upfront costs in monthly savings. If you don’t plan on staying in the home beyond the break-even point, it may not be worth buying down the mortgage rate.
  • Available Funds: Evaluate your financial situation to determine if you have the necessary funds to buy down your mortgage rate. It’s essential to ensure this investment doesn’t strain your overall financial stability.
  • Future Interest Rate Trends: Assess whether current mortgage rates are already favorable. If rates are historically low, the potential savings from buying down your rate might not be significant.

What Is A Mortgage Rate?

A mortgage rate refers to the interest charged on a mortgage loan. It determines the cost of borrowing for the homebuyer.

How Does A Lower Mortgage Rate Benefit Me?

Securing a lower mortgage rate can lead to significant savings over the life of the loan. It can lower your monthly payments and reduce the total interest paid.

Is It Worth Buying Down The Mortgage Rate?

Buying down the mortgage rate can be worth it if you plan to stay in the home long enough to recoup the cost through lower monthly payments.

What Factors Influence Mortgage Rates?

Mortgage rates are influenced by the economy, inflation, the housing market, credit scores, and the type of loan. Understanding these factors can help you secure a favorable rate.
